Rigging tube to Yamaha 130. Clamp for tube at engine?
I installed a TH Marine rigging tube today to clean up the transom. The motor has a 2" OD rubber grommet that the hose slips over and its snug but not tight. I would like something nicer than a hose clamp or big zip tie to snug it down. Any suggestions?
